Cant Uninstall the Autodesk Desktop Licensing Service on macOS
I followed the steps in the website, but the thing that should appear on my MacBook isn't appearing, and I'm not able to uninstall it, the step says that:
- Start typing sh and then drag and drop the script into the Terminal window. The command will auto complete into something similar to: sh /path/to/UninstallAdskLicensingService.sh
- Press ENTER to execute the command. Note: Terminal will ask for a password. Type your Mac password and press ENTER (no character is shown as you type).
- BUT WHEN I DO THE SECOND STEP IT APPEARS SOMETHING ELSE

The steps on this page has a few more that you show...
1. Download the script UninstallAdskLicensingService.sh.
2. Open Terminal (Go > Utilities > Terminal).
3. Start typing sh ...
Did you get a chance to do those other items?
It also says...
Note: The above steps are sufficient in the majority of cases. However, you can also perform a full clean uninstall of the Licensing service by also removing/renaming the folder AdskLicensingService located in C:\ProgramData\Autodesk (Windows) or /Library/Application\ Support/Autodesk/AdskLicensingService/ (macOS). This folder includes licensing cached configuration files. If removed, do note that a reinstall of all 2020+ software will be needed in order to re-register all with the Licensing service.
